Formerly Female-Dominated Kentucky Jobs will Grow Fastest

Kentucky women have been working in jobs traditionally held by women, with secretaries at the top the list. However, the stat'e women have been working in other traditional roles as well, including private household services, financial records processing, health assessment and treatment, health techs, and cashiers.

Kentucky women have not largely worked in nontraditional, male-oriented occupations, including only small percentages as police and firefighters, engineers, construction laborers, material movers, mechanics and construction trades-people (in journeyman programs).

The occupational outlook may be better for Kentucky women than for Kentucky men at this time, through the year 2014.

Men and women are equally likely to have jobs that are projected to decline by 2005. However, men are more likely to be in jobs with low growth rates, while women are more likely to be in jobs with high growth rates.

Traditional "female-dominated" services and health care types of occupations are predicted to experience high growth or even hyper-growth (over 30 percent). One exception is the field of Network Systems and Data Communications Analysts, with a projected 57% growth margin through 2014. This trend may spur increasing numbers of men to enter nursing schools for RN programs.

Other occupations entered into by increasing numbers of men include physical therapy assisting and medical assisting. The aging American population is creating a need for these types of jobs in greater numbers.


Top 7 Highest-Paying Kentucky Jobs

The Top 7 high paying jobs require an Associate's Degree or Higher educational certificate, diploma, or license.

(Job title, Annual # of Openings through 2014, and Hourly Wage)

Registered Nurses (RN): 1,728, $24.07

General & Operations Managers:921, $36.05

Elementary School Teachers, Except Special Ed.:694, $24.50

Other Teachers & Instructors: 495, $12.44

Secondary School Teachers, Except Spec/Voc Ed.: 418, $25.53

Accountants & Auditors:376, $23.70

Chief Executives: 330, $62.62
